2004 Mitsubishi L 200 vs. 2006 Subaru Impreza

To start off, 2006 Subaru Impreza is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Mitsubishi L 200.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Mitsubishi L 200 would be higher. At 2,457 cc (4 cylinders), 2006 Subaru Impreza is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Subaru Impreza (227 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 117 more horse power than 2004 Mitsubishi L 200. (110 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2006 Subaru Impreza should accelerate faster than 2004 Mitsubishi L 200.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Mitsubishi L 200 weights approximately 295 kg more than 2006 Subaru Impreza.

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Subaru Impreza (320 Nm @ 3600 RPM) has 80 more torque (in Nm) than 2004 Mitsubishi L 200. (240 Nm @ 2000 RPM). This means 2006 Subaru Impreza will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2004 Mitsubishi L 200.
